THE ORTHODOX CHURCH HAS THE BEST SOCIAL INSTITUTION IN CONGO
Dr. Emilienne Raoul, the Minister of Social Affairs of the Republic of the Congo, expressed most favorable views gleaned from her visit to the “St Efstathios” Orphanage of the Holy Diocese of Congo-Brazzaville and Gabon, in Dolisie, to His Grace Panteleimon, Bishop of Congo-Brazzaville, during the meeting they had on 17th October 2014 at the Ministry. “Congratulations! The Orthodox Church has the best social institution in the country” said the Minister, who declared her total satisfaction on the cleanliness and the order which is prevalent there, the quality of food and clothing of the children being cared for there, as well as the faithful implementation of the relevant legislation on charitable institutions.
His Grace, who met with the Minister to express the gratitude of the local Church for her visit to the Orphanage, reported in detail the vital financial contribution of the missionary societies of Greece to the establishment and operation of the Orphanage, as well as that of Ecclesiastical Organizations, agents and private persons from Greece and Cyprus, who contribute, in the midst of severe financial crisis, to this philanthropic effort. He also passed on to Dr. Raoul the paternal blessings and gratitude of His Beatitude Theodoros II, Pope and Patriarch of Alexandria and All Africa, and discussed with her ways of collaborations for the benefit of the children.
Also present at the meeting were the Reverend Fr. Bernard Diafouka, Parish Priest of the Parish Community of the Resurrection of the Lord in Brazzaville, as well as the Director of the Minister’s Private office.
